BERNICE O’BRIEN

     Bernice O’Brien, 79, passed away surrounded by family Monday, Feb. 3, 2025, at Meadowbrook in Black River Falls, WI.

     Bernice was born Aug. 20, 1945, to George and Pearline (Mathews) Madland in Black River Falls. She attended school up to ninth grade. She married Wesley Stoddard Jr. in 1964, and five children came from this union. They later divorced. She was united in marriage to Archie O’Brien Jr. Feb. 18, 1985. She raised a family and a grandson and could always be counted on as the family babysitter. She worked for a while at a restaurant in Merrillan. She was the head problem-solver in the family.

     She enjoyed crocheting and listening to country music. She liked going fishing, taking walks outside and picnicking. She loved singing karaoke and spending time with her grandchildren and great-grandchildren. She loved a good game of bingo and playing canasta. Everyone called her “Grandma” or “Bunny.”

     She is preceded in death by her husband, Archie; her parents, George Sr. and Pearline; children Lori and James; grandson Ryan; great-grandson Porter; grandparents Frank and Viola Horvich; brother George Madland Jr.; brother-in-law Ed Johnson; sister Ester Gray; niece and nephew Mark and Debra Johnson; and ex-husband, Wesley Stoddard.

     Bernice is survived by her children, Ken Stoddard, Randy (Roselyn) Stoddard, Lani Wetzel and Charles (Tara) O’Brien; 15 grandchildren; 12 great-grandchildren; and sisters, Cora “Lavon” Johnson and Starline Weyand; along with several nieces and nephews.

     The funeral service for Bernice was held at 12 p.m. Friday, Feb. 7, 2025, at Jensen-Modjeski Funeral Home in Hixton. A visitation was held at the funeral home from 11 a.m. until the time of service. Burial will take place at a later date in Hatfield Cemetery. 

     Jensen-Modjeski Funeral Home is assisting the family with arrangements.
